The cheapest way to get from Perth to Vichy is to bus and train which costs €100 - €190 and takes 28h 51m.
The fastest way to get from Perth to Vichy is to train which takes 13h 39m and costs €350 - €700.
No, there is no direct train from Perth to Vichy. However, there are services departing from Perth and arriving at Vichy via Edinburgh Waverley, London St Pancras Intl, Paris Nord and Paris Bercy.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 39m.
The distance between Perth and Vichy is 1538 km.
The best way to get from Perth to Vichy without a car is to train which takes 13h 39m and costs €350 - €700.
It takes approximately 13h 39m to get from Perth to Vichy, including transfers.
